11 tracked promises
“Eliminate property taxes on homesteaded Florida homes by placing a constitutional amendment on the 2026 ballot, starting with a large homestead exemption and phasing toward full elimination.”
“Expand Florida's E-Verify employment-eligibility requirement to cover all employers (including those with fewer than 25 workers) and sign that expansion into law.”
“Complete the remaining Everglades restoration projects, pursuing a federal block grant so the state can finish the work itself.”
“Recommend increased state funding dedicated to raising teacher salaries in the state budget.”
“Eliminate Florida's business rent tax (the tax on commercial leases).”
“Create a Florida DOGE task force to eliminate government waste and bloat and cut redundant boards and commissions.”
“Fund the My Safe Florida Home program to clear the waitlist of homeowners seeking home-hardening grants.”
“Continue the civics bonus program that pays a $3,000 bonus to teachers who complete the state's civics seal of excellence training.”
“Create a 'Second Amendment summer' sales-tax holiday for purchases of firearms, ammunition and accessories.”
“Add a new sales-tax holiday on marine fuel to benefit boaters and anglers.”
“Not seek to raise state taxes.”
